#2597eb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2597eb is composed of 14.5% red, 59.2% green and 92.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.3% cyan, 35.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 205.5 degrees, a saturation of 83.2% and a lightness of 53.3%. #2597eb color hex could be obtained by blending #4affff with #002fd7. Closest websafe color is: #3399ff.

Shades and Tints of #2597eb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010a10 is the darkest color, while #fdfe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#2597eb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#81898f is the less saturated color, while #139afd is the most saturated one.
